FinSA and the new Ombudsman Office: between heaven and hell

This is a small revolution in the Swiss financial industry. As of 1st January 2020, the Federal Law on Financial Services (FinSA), the Law on Financial Institutions (FinIA) and the Law on the Control of Precious Metals (PMCA) will introduce an obligation for several professionals of the Swiss financial industry (in particular independent asset managers, trustees, collective asset managers, fund management companies, securities firms, client advisors and commercial assayers) to affiliate to an ombudsman office within six months of the recognition of such an office by the Federal Department of Finance (FDF).
